Genesis Block Entrepreneurs Moving and Shaking in the Wilmington Area
The entrepreneurs and companies at Genesis Block continue to make great strides in achieving their business goals and promoting community prosperity. Here are some of the superlatives in our entrepreneurial community.
Tiffany Machler, Owner of Art by Nugget
Tiffany Machler, owner of Art by Nugget, a boutique art gallery located in Wilmington, NC is having a wonderful summer. In July she was selected as a finalist for the Wilma Women to Watch Awards, which highlights business women in the Cape Fear region doing great work. Tiffany was also commissioned by Lowe’s to paint a mural that commemorates the 100th anniversary of Lowe’s.
Erika Edwards and Kristi Ray, Owners of Honey Head Films
Erika Edwards and Kristi Ray are becoming the Wilmington area maestros of curated content for small business owners, social impact projects and entrepreneurs. The full service, female production company was selected as a finalist for the Wilma Women to Watch Awards. They were featured in the August issue of Wrightsville Beach Magazine showcasing the buzz they are creating in the community. Not to be outdone. A Song For Imogene, the company’s feature film, was one of eleven recipients of the 2021 grant for the Filmed in NC Fund in conjunction with the Cucalorus Film Foundation.
Michelle Bethea, Owner of Serving With A Gift LLC
Michelle Bethea has just launched Elaborate Outings, a full service luxury picnic experience company that creates upscale outdoor outings for private events, ceremonies and team building exercises. Michelle is a graduate of the Genesis Block Jumpstart Academy and has attracted a significant following in the region. Michelle was featured in the Star News for her trendy business and traction in the area.
William and Shemeka Stokes, Owners of Jayski’s Rub a Dub LLC
Jay and Shemeka Stokes, Co-owners of Jay Ski’s Rub-A-Dub LLC, have developed a strong spice brand in southeastern North Carolina. The couple were members of Team Tsunami in the first minority accelerator cohort at Genesis Block. The company recently was selected for a grant from Live Oak Resource Center to expand their operation. Jayski’s has also partnered with Cameron Art Museum’s CAM Café to share recipes in the fall.
James and Myra McDuffie, Owners of MeMa’s Chick N Ribs
James and Myra McDuffie are the talk of Pender County. MeMa’s Chick N Ribs, located in Burgaw, North Carolina, is one of the areas favorite restaurants. The company was awarded the 2021 Coastal Entrepreneur Awards winner in the Minority Owned Business category. Up next for the company is a major expansion that will include a larger restaurant, event space and manufacturing center in Burgaw.
Albert Steed, Cofounder and CEO of Hybrid AF
Hybrid AF connect gyms and athletes into one solid, supportive network of 24 hour, 7 day a week gyms that encourages athletes to take accountability and pride in their own fitness. Cofounder and CEO Albert Steed, leads the company and they service over 250 gyms around the world. Hybrid AF was awarded the 2020 Coastal Entrepreneur Award in the Internet Related Business category.
Tiffany Hansley-Jones, Co-owner of Jones Sunset Sauce, LLC
Jones Sunset Sauce is becoming well known in the Cape Fear region for its versatility and great pairing with cookouts and family gatherings. CEO Tiffany Hansley Jones, is driving a strategy that focuses on distribution with local restaurants, grocery stores and farmers market. They are having great success with distribution in 6 locations in the Cape Fear region.
